Former U.S. men’s Olympics gold medalist and current transgender conservative influencer Caitlyn Jenner is in Israel after the nation launched a strike on Iran, which triggered a series of retaliatory missile strikes. Jenner was in the country for the Pride Month parade in Tel Aviv, scheduled for Friday. However, as tensions escalated, Iranian missile strikes began hitting the city, causing widespread chaos.
Jenner documented her experience on social media, sharing photos of the bomb shelters and the devastation caused by the Iranian strikes. In one of her posts, she described the situation in Tel Aviv, noting that it was the third wave of attacks from Iran. She also posted a photo from the Western Wall in Jerusalem, accompanied by a caption expressing her support for Israel. Her posts included both Israeli and U.S. flag emojis, reinforcing her allegiance to the country.
In addition to her social media activity, Jenner shared images of the missiles flying through the Tel Aviv skyline, showcasing the scale of the destruction. However, an Israeli man named Regev Gur captured a photo of her in the shelter, drinking wine, which sparked discussions about the circumstances surrounding her presence in the shelters during the strikes. The image was accompanied by a caption that questioned whether she was following the safety protocols of the bomb shelters.
The Israeli government confirmed that an Iranian missile strike hit several cities, causing serious damage and resulting in dozens of injuries. Emergency crews were reported to be working to rescue people from the rubble, with reports of buildings being either flooded or destroyed. As per Magen David Adom, 34 people were injured, including some critically and seriously wounded individuals. The reports highlighted the severity of the situation as the conflict continued to unfold.
Meanwhile, Fox News’ chief foreign correspondent, Trey Yingst, provided live updates, describing the extensive damage to the area near Israel’s military headquarters, the Kiryat. He reported that emergency personnel were searching for people trapped in the buildings, with some structures described as having been completely destroyed or flooded.
